site design / logo © 2021 Stack Exchange Inc; user contributions licensed under cc by-sa. If they aren’t configured, select AC Sweep and enter 1 for Start Freq and 10e6 for End Freq. How to set the Ngspice library path ? Ngspice is a general-purpose Electrical / Electronics circuit simulation program for nonlinear and linear analysis. Depending upon the gate bias there are different regions of operation in C-V curve that are accumulation, depletion and strong inversion. Open the opamp1.sch example from the ngspice example folder. Types of MOSFET Operating Modes. When this (Vgs) threshold … Is Xyce 100% compatible with SPICE ? We can use it to try out some circuit simulations as we go through the semester. added Xyce Mosfet nfin #177; V1.3.2 2019-03-11. support Ngspice 30 and Xyce 6.10; fixed NgSpice and Xyce support on Windows 10; bug fixes; V1.2.0 2018-06-07. MOSFET transistor I-V characteristics iD K 2()vGS–Vt vDS vDS 2 = [] – iD vGS vDS--+ + iD Kv()GS–Vt 2 = []()1 + λvDS K W 2L = -----Kn Kn Coxµ n i = Linear region: D = K[]2()vGS–Vt vDS vDS sat = vGS–Vt vDS«vGS–Vt Triode region: vDS Vt + n+ Q n+ B0 VS>0 QI VDS > 0. In this example, we will use this netlist: The ngspice simulator can be invoked from the terminal command line via: This brings up the simulator in interactive mode, and you are presented with a prompt: To load our circuit netlist named mos_characteristics.sp, we type in the command at the ngspice prompt: Note that the simulator has performed the analysis we have specified in the control section of the input netlist: a DC analysis, sweeping the voltage source vd from 0V to 1V, in steps of 0.01V. EEEI Bldg., Velasquez St., Quezon City 1101 448 3 3 silver badges 18 18 bronze badges \$\endgroup\$ \$\begingroup\$ Netlist 2 doesn't have a proper analysis statement. Xyce is an open source, SPICE-compatible, high-performance analog circuit simulator, capable of solving extremely large circuit problems developed at Sandia National Laboratories. ng_start.exe is a MS Windows application loading ngspice.dll dynamically. ##### import matplotlib.pyplot as plt ##### import PySpice.Logging.Logging as Logging logger = Logging. Q1 Default RB 100E3Ω + 2V VIN RC 1E3Ω + 5V VCC IB 12.206 µA + VOUT 3.779 V +-VBE 779.365 mV IC 1.221 mA 2.1 Contributors; Introduction to NGSpice NGSpice . Example: .DC Vds 0 5 0.5 Vgs 0 5 1 In the example above, the voltage Vds will be swept from 0 to 5V in steps of 1V for every value of Vgs..AC Statement This statement is used to specify the frequency (AC) analysis. How to set the simulator ? LTspice is mainly used in windo ws operating system. Diodes are used as examples to explain how SPICE device models are constructed. Diodes are used as examples to explain how SPICE device models are constructed. You can access the user manual here. After the initial header, the "netlist" begins. share | improve this question | follow | asked Nov 30 '18 at 7:18. kevin kevin. ngspice 3 -> dc vg 0 1 0.01 Doing analysis at TEMP = 27.000000 and TNOM = 27.000000 No. Ok, Thanks for your fast response Andy!. Why would a regiment of soldiers be armed with giant warhammers instead of more conventional medieval weapons? However, it is not an ngspice how-to or introductory text. To learn more, see our tips on writing great answers. Here are themost important ones: 1. SUM110N04 datasheet … Four executables (coming with source code) serve as examples for controlling ngspice. Dot DC SRCNAM VSTART VSTOP VINCR SRC2 START2 STOP2 INCR2 . Ngspice ist eine freie Software zur Schaltungssimulation.Es ist der Open-Source-Nachfolger der Berkeley SPICE Version 3, dem Urahnen aller Schaltungssimulatoren. PS. .title Sample MOSFET circuit.options badchr=1 ingold=1 numdgt=4.include 2n7000.inc ;include the subcircuit and model for 2N7000 *model terminals in order are: drain,gate,source *Voltage source at input to MOSFET *transitions from 0v to 5v after 10ms delay, pulse width is 10msec, repeats in 50ms 3 Tweet. In this tutorial, we will examine MOSFETs using a simple DC circuit and a CMOS inverter with DC sweep analysis.! Now when I try to run this I get the following error: Which is not realy a supprise, after all, how should ngspice know the characterics of all components in the digikey catalogue. Announcements. Abode plot is generated. How do I simulate a circuit containing a Mosfet, and transform the values in the datasheet of the mosfet into ngspice. The MOSFET starts with an ‘M’, the resistor … Well organized and easy to understand Web building tutorials with lots of examples of how to use HTML, CSS, JavaScript, SQL, PHP, Python, Bootstrap, Java and XML. Same for the 'ad' and 'as' parameters these are the drain and source 'diffusions'. What language(s) implements function return value by assigning to the function name, generating lists of integers with constraint. If a jet engine is bolted to the equator, does the Earth speed up? First, we need a transistor model file. It only takes a minute to sign up. setup_logging ##### from PySpice.Doc.ExampleTools import find_libraries from PySpice.Probe.Plot import plot from … Collection of tools to use with ngspice. The dc voltage source V OS models the op-amp input offset voltage. v Tn=1V, v Tp= -1V, both transistors have k’(W/L)=1mA/V2. The following deck computes the output characteristics of a MOSFET device over the range 0-10V for VDS and 0-5V for VGS. FOR MOSFET CHANNELS Want to ensure accurate L dependance of models – Benchmark: KF parameter 0 i fl 2 f = KF0⋅I D AF C OX L2 f 1 i fl 2 f = KF1⋅I D AF C OX LW f 2 &3 i fl 2 f = KF2⋅g m 2 C OX LW f AF NLEV PSD All bad models for deep sub-micron (No 1/L3 dependance) [Çelik-Butler, 1999] name,type,vds,vgs,gm,etc.) The purpose of the Qucs-S subproject is to use free SPICE circuit simulation kernels with the Qucs GUI. Qucs-S is a spin-off of the Qucs cross-platform circuit simulator. With the help of some external components, an op amp, which is an active circuit element, can perform mathematical operations such as addition, subtraction, multiplication, division, differentiation and integration. Do I understand it correctly that we are basicly bypassing the internal MOSFET model of ngspice with a sub-circuit build up of discrete elements? Stack Exchange network consists of 176 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. For a quick introduction to ngspice, you can visit their website, or you can proceed to the download page. How to Learn Python; 7.2. All power device models are centralized in dedicated library files, according to their voltage class and product technology. The spice model for the STN2NF10 is found on this page: -. How do I simulate a circuit containing a Mosfet, and transform the values in the datasheet of the mosfet into ngspice. 6.12. How to Run these Examples; 7.3. Ngspice for MS Windows, reading, simulating and writing wav audio files. If you are interested in getting more in-depth information, you may refer to our book page or to a list of third party tutorials. added Xyce Mosfet nfin #177; V1.3.2 2019-03-11. support Ngspice 30 and Xyce 6.10; fixed NgSpice and Xyce support on Windows 10; bug fixes; V1.2.0 2018-06-07. SPICE Device Models: Principle of Operation of Diodes. Asking for help, clarification, or responding to other answers. Other node voltages are also displayed. These are only added to aid the user to compare MOSFETs. To specify a circuit, we need to create a netlist. Half-/Full-bridge N-channel power MOSFET drivers. NGSPICE User Manual Describes ngspice-rework-17 Draft Version 0.2 Many Authors Vdd 3 0 dc 5 * Supply voltage Vdd=5V. Simulating MOSFETS in Spice To perform simulation with MOSFETS in our circuits will require that we learn a few more things about Spice simulation. So far I've succesfully done a simulation with a simple voltage source, and resistor. Thank you very much! To all MSEE (Microelectronics) graduates of the MICROLAB: Please take a moment to answer this 7-question survey.

Washington County, Nc Property Search, Parma Pizza Uppskrift, Vegan Friendly Restaurants Sydney Cbd, How To Receive Western Union Online, Switzerland Female Names, Order Of The Red Dragon, Islamic Tips For Beautiful Face, Easemytrip Hotel Registration, Tui Uk Online Check-in,